Julien Wadel 1667b78b4b Fix crashs on video call.
- do deleteLater on QObjects.
- Queued QQuickFramebufferObject updates.
- Clean Linphone SDK window ID on Camera deletion (Qml side, it cannot be done on C++ beacause of asynchroneous signals).
- Do cleaning synchronization between calls window and fullscreen.
- Avoid to rebuild all entries of ChatRoom when below minimum limits (keep this feature to avoid loading time when initiate the call).

#include "ParticipantImdnStateProxyModel.hpp"
#include <QQmlApplicationEngine>
#include "app/App.hpp"
#include "utils/Utils.hpp"
#include "components/Components.hpp"
#include "ParticipantImdnStateListModel.hpp"
#include "ParticipantImdnStateModel.hpp"
// =============================================================================
ParticipantImdnStateProxyModel::ParticipantImdnStateProxyModel (QObject *parent) : QSortFilterProxyModel(parent){
}
bool ParticipantImdnStateProxyModel::filterAcceptsRow (
int sourceRow,
const QModelIndex &sourceParent
) const {
Q_UNUSED(sourceRow)
Q_UNUSED(sourceParent)
//const QModelIndex index = sourceModel()->index(sourceRow, 0, sourceParent);
//const ParticipantDeviceModel *device = index.data().value<ParticipantDeviceModel *>();
return true;
}
bool ParticipantImdnStateProxyModel::lessThan (const QModelIndex &left, const QModelIndex &right) const {
const ParticipantImdnStateModel *imdnA = sourceModel()->data(left).value<ParticipantImdnStateModel *>();
const ParticipantImdnStateModel *imdnB = sourceModel()->data(right).value<ParticipantImdnStateModel *>();
return imdnA->getState() < imdnB->getState()
|| (imdnA->getState() == imdnB->getState() && imdnA->getStateChangeTime() < imdnB->getStateChangeTime());
}
//---------------------------------------------------------------------------------
int ParticipantImdnStateProxyModel::getCount(){
return rowCount();
}
ChatMessageModel * ParticipantImdnStateProxyModel::getChatMessageModel(){
return mChatMessageModel;
}
void ParticipantImdnStateProxyModel::setChatMessageModel(ChatMessageModel * message){
mChatMessageModel = message;
if(message){
ParticipantImdnStateListModel *model = static_cast<ParticipantImdnStateListModel*>(sourceModel());
ParticipantImdnStateListModel *messageModel = message->getParticipantImdnStates().get();
if( model != messageModel){
if(model)
disconnect(model, &ParticipantImdnStateListModel::countChanged, this, &ParticipantImdnStateProxyModel::countChanged);
setSourceModel(messageModel);
connect(messageModel, &ParticipantImdnStateListModel::countChanged, this, &ParticipantImdnStateProxyModel::countChanged);
sort(0);
emit countChanged();
}
}
emit chatMessageModelChanged();
}
